Abstract

SSL protocol is essential in network security. This paper evaluates the security of SSL protocol by a fine-grained analysis method based on freshness identifiers and proposes the causes of two kinds of MITM attacks under the circumstance of admitting the difficulties of building a trusted session key without a PKI or a long-term hold shared key. These evaluation and analysis have certain reference significance on protocols analysis.
